Young journalist, benefit from a scholarship to come and work in Brussels

Le Lenaic Fund for the 'quality journalism' offers a five-month scholarship and placement to a young European journalist, graduate, in a European media, starting from March 2019. Do not delay! The deadline for applications is December 31, 2018.

You can apply if you are: 1) a woman; 2) a graduate from a country of the European Union, 3) under 28, 4) who wishes to embark on a career as a journalist specializing in European affairs in Brussels.

Each selected person benefits from:

  • A grant of up to 5000 euros
  • An internship of up to 6 months in one of the many media located in Brussels specializing in European affairs
  • The next course will take place from the beginning of March to the end of July 2019

NB: The Lenaïc fund was set up by the family and loved ones of our young colleague, who died of a devastating illness far too early (read here).
